The discussion is intended for an audience of yoga teachers, health professionals, and anyone else who is interested in exploring some of the structural and functional aspects of hatha yoga. Most of the emphasis is practical-doing experiments, learning to observe the body, and further refining actions and observations.
Special emphasis has been placed on the musculoskeletal, nervous, respiratory, and cardiovascular systems-the musculoskletal system because that is where all our actions are expressed, the nervous system because that is the residence of all the managerial functions of the musculoskeletal system, the respiratory system because breathing is of such paramount importance in yoga, and the cardiovascular system because inverted postures cannot be fully comprehended without understanding the dynamics of the circulations.
